Title: Support roller installation question...
Post by: colkking on October 07, 2024, 08:59:23 PM
Guys, I have a question.  I can't figure this out (in all honesty, I'm not too bright).
Trying to install my support roller on the drivers side.  I just rebuilt the support roller assembly, with new bearings and gaskets.  I have tightened the bolt on the shaft so that the gap between the mounting holes is EXACTLY what it was when I took the assembly off the top of the crab.
Well, as you can imagine, the two inboard bolts mount up without a problem.  HOWEVER, the two outboard bracket mounting holes are about 1/4" off from the outboard crab installation holes.
I took an old support roller assembly, and it also doesn't line up.
Any thoughts on how I can bet these bracket mounting holes to line up with the crab mounting holes?

Title: Re: Support roller installation question...
Post by: Jesse on October 11, 2024, 06:53:49 AM
If you replaced the bearings, they may not be the same thickness. You may have to reduce the length of the spacer between the bearings. Ive seen this too.
